The non-profit organization was formed by Cheryl Haggard and Sandy Puc in April of 2005 after their personal experience of loosing their child. They named the organization NILMDTS (Now I Lay Me Down To Sleep) after the children’s bedtime prayer. The organization and it’s photographers has provided thousands of families of babies who are stillborn or are at risk of dying as newborns free professional portraits with their baby. NILMDTS has nearly 3, 200 affiliated photographers in 12 countries worldwide. This is an incredible organization and my heart goes out for them and the families they care for.
